How to Convert Day to Month (mean)

1 day = 0.0328542 month (mean)s

Month (mean) = Day × 0.0328542

Example: 673 d × 0.0328542 = 22.111 mo

Reverse Conversion

To convert month (mean)s back to days:

  • Remember, 1 month (mean) equals 30.4375 days.
  • To convert 22.111 mo to d, multiply 22.111 x 30.4375, resulting in 673 d.
